Output ea312092788ccb6fe51ae9394916f83d136d794903dc1ea46e88185daabc2a5b:30

value
885576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2d8a996eeb807d20039732597eef2e0ce04eb2a OP_EQUAL
address
3NNUBsMcom1sW9oerDYawJLbpcMXVdx7yh
transaction
ea312092788ccb6fe51ae9394916f83d136d794903dc1ea46e88185daabc2a5b
spent
true